当我尝试通过使用imageView.isHidden = true在项目中的许多图像中隐藏图像时,所有图像都被隐藏(并且在使用imageViewHidden.isHidden = false时图像不会回来),而不是我因为imageView是UIImageView类的Collective对象。
请让我知道如何在项目中的两个或更多图像中隐藏特定图像。
我知道可以通过使用用于特定图像的对象来完成,但是我有两个类
答案 0 :(得分:0)
如果要隐藏imageView,请使用引用相同imageView的相同插座 (例如imageView1.isHidden = true)
或使用标签值在同一ViewController上隐藏imageView,方法是
if let imageView1 = cell.viewWithTag(100) as? UIImageView {
imageView1.isHidden = true
}
如果要取消隐藏同一图像视图,请编写代码
imageView1.isHidden = false
确保您要使用相同的imageView插座,以显示或隐藏。